The Best in Attic Insulation

The proper amount of attic insulation will make your home energy efficient and help you save money on energy and cooling expenses.

Most homeowners do not have insulation installed to the proper depth, which means your ceilings are the biggest contributors to “heat gain”. That means heat can transfer through your ceiling to compete with the cool air flowing from your registers.

Does my home have enough attic insulation?

If your attic insulation is less than 7” deep, you don’t have enough. We recommend 13” to 14” for optimal efficiency.

If your home was built more than 10 years ago, your attic insulation is likely not up to code.

In both cases, improving your attic insulation will improve your energy efficiency and lower your monthly bills.

    Types Of Attic Insulation

     

    Attic insulation comes in a variety of types and materials, each with their own advantages. The most common type is fiberglass batt insulation, which consists of flexible fibers made from molten glass. It is easy to install but has a low R-value per inch thickness compared to other options. Loose-fill cellulose insulation is another popular option; it’s made from recycled newspaper and requires no additional protection or chemical treatment. Additionally, spray foam insulation can be installed quickly and provides superior air sealing performance due to its ability to expand into cracks and crevices.

     

    The two main factors that must be considered when deciding between different types of attic insulation are the climate zone for your home as well as budget constraints. In climates where temperatures fluctuate frequently throughout the year, such as Florida's Sunny Isles Beach, more efficient products like closed-cell spray foam may provide better value than less expensive alternatives due to reduced energy costs over time. On the other hand, if cost is an important factor then loose-fill cellulose might present a good solution since it doesn't require extra vapor barriers or professional installation services.

     

    When selecting an appropriate type of attic insulation for any home or building, both thermal resistance (R-value) and environmental sustainability should also be taken into account. Energy Star recommends using high R-values for colder climates while having enough ventilation to prevent moisture buildup in warmer areas; properly sealed attics will help ensure these conditions are met even during unexpected temperature swings. Factors such as installation complexity and material toxicity should also be considered before making a final decision on which type of attic insulation best meets one’s needs. With this information at hand, homeowners can make informed decisions about how they want to insulate their properties moving forward—an important step towards reducing energy bills while creating healthier living spaces.

    Preparing An Attic For Installation

     

    Once the decision has been made to install attic insulation, it is important for homeowners to properly prepare their attic for the installation process. This includes ensuring that all items are removed from the area, assessing any existing damage and addressing necessary repairs, including ventilation systems, wiring or plumbing issues. Additionally, it is essential to check attic access points such as doors and hatches to ensure they can support the weight of an installer entering with supplies.

     

    Inspecting an attic before installing insulation also requires checking for pests; birds and rodents can cause severe damage to both individuals and property if not addressed in a timely manner. Homeowners should look for nesting materials, droppings or other signs of infestation when preparing attics for insulation installation services. If these signs exist, pest control professionals should be consulted immediately prior to commencing work on any project involving attic insulation.

    Cost Estimates For Installation Services

     

    The cost of attic insulation installation services in Sunny Isles Beach, FL will depend on the size and complexity of the project. Homeowners can expect to pay between $1.00-$2.50 per square foot for fiberglass or cellulose insulation, while installing spray foam insulation might be more expensive at around $3.00-$6.00 per square foot. Additional costs may include materials such as vapor barriers and drywall repairs if needed. Professional installers can provide an estimate based on the type of insulation they are using and any labor costs associated with the job.

    Maintenance And Upkeep After Installation

     

    A well-installed attic insulation system should remain effective for many years. To ensure the ongoing efficiency and safety of an attic insulation system, regular maintenance is essential. Inspection tasks include checking for rodent activity or pest infestations as these can potentially damage insulation materials. Other periodic maintenance activities include ensuring that all electrical connections are secure to avoid overheating, verifying proper mechanical ventilation, inspecting fire stops and other barriers against smoke, and looking for potential air leaks around doors and windows.

     

    It is also important to inspect the condition of existing insulation materials periodically in order to identify any signs of deterioration due to age or environmental conditions such as moisture levels or high temperatures. If damaged insulation needs replacement, it is best to use professional services so that the work is done correctly with minimal disruption. Proper disposal must be considered when removing old insulation because some types may contain hazardous material like asbestos fibers which require special treatment before they can be discarded into a landfill safely.

    Latest Trends In Attic Insulation Solutions

     

    Attic insulation is an important component of home energy efficiency, as it helps to reduce heat loss and control the temperature inside a building. There are several options when it comes to attic insulation solutions, each with its own advantages and disadvantages. The latest trends in attic insulation include:

     

    * Spray Foam Insulation – This type of insulation offers superior coverage compared to traditional batts or blankets, providing better airtightness that can help reduce drafts and improve indoor comfort levels. It also has a high R-value rating for effective thermal performance.

     

    * Radiant Barrier Foil – Designed to reflect heat away from your roof deck during hot weather, this lightweight material can be installed either directly on top of existing insulation or between rafters in new construction projects. It's a great way to keep your attic cooler while reducing energy bills.

     

    * Recycled Cellulose Fiber Insulation– Made from recycled paper products such as newspaper, cardboard, and other wood fibers, this type of insulation is considered one of the most eco-friendly options available today. Its ability to expand into small spaces makes it ideal for tight areas like attics or basements where airflow may be limited.

     

    In addition to these popular types of attic insulation solutions, there are many more advances taking place in this field including natural fiber-based insulations and aerogel technologies which provide excellent thermal protection without sacrificing breathability or moisture control capabilities.     What Is The Average Lifespan Of An Attic Insulation Installation?

     

    Attic insulation installation is a key factor in ensuring the longevity of one's home. It is like building a wall that provides support and protection from the elements, yet allows air to circulate. The average lifespan of an attic insulation installation depends on several variables: quality of materials used, geographic location, temperature fluctuations, and proper maintenance.

     

    To start with, higher-grade materials typically have longer lifespans than lower grade ones; for example, polyurethane foam may last up to 50 years as compared to fiberglass which lasts about 15–20 years. Additionally, geographical considerations such as the area’s climate can also affect how long an attic insulation will last. Areas prone to extreme temperatures are likely to experience faster deterioration due to thermal expansion or contraction. Finally, regular inspections and maintenance play an important role in extending its lifespan by detecting early signs of damage and identifying potential issues before they become more serious problems.

     

    Here are some tips for maintaining your attic insulation:

     

    * Check regularly for any wear and tear caused by rodents or pests

    * Ensure adequate ventilation in order to prevent moisture build-up

    * Inspect areas around pipes and other sources of water leaks
